Timken HM136948-90410 is a two-row tapered roller bearing assembly (AP type) with factory-matched cone, cup, and spacer designated by match code 90410. This Class G assembly is designed for heavy-duty axle and pinion applications, providing pre-set internal clearance and runout for simplified installation in industrial and mobile equipment.

Read moreHow do I choose the right type of bearing for my application?
Start with the load and how it’s applied. You need to know if you’re dealing with radial loads, axial loads, or a mix of both. Then look at speed, operating environment, and space constraints. For example, ball bearings are great for high speed and lighter loads, while roller bearings handle heavier loads but usually at lower speeds. If there’s contamination, moisture, or heat involved, you may need sealed bearings or specific materials. In most cases, the right choice comes down to matching load type, speed, and environment to the bearing design.
